Abstract
In order to develop self-healing soft robots, we
developed an integrated approach consisting of several essential
building blocks from new intrinsic autonomous and nonautonomous
self-healing polymers with fillers for additional
functionality, different processing techniques to autonomous
healing soft robots with embedded self-healing sensors and
heaters. This technology was experimentally validated in several
soft robotic demonstrators.
